Transaction ef08964c567a3a45399cee6d421cd40cf533121fcb58f7a13fe6c499512534d4
1 Input
1 Output
-
ef08964c567a3a45399cee6d421cd40cf533121fcb58f7a13fe6c499512534d4:0
- value
- 981564
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d33d84046f035c3a005964d9baf24b733a3e3cf OP_EQUAL
- address
- 32tppGmGQxm8PZbaUvuwDL4YM9kcTJsrwH